Kay County seeks jail escapees

NEWKIRK — Authorities on Tuesday continued to search for two Kay County inmates — including a possible three-time escapee — who fled the county jail late Monday night.
Darrin Muegge , 40, of Tonkawa, and Terrance Cottingham , 18, of Pawhuska left the Kay County jail through a fire escape door sometime after 11 p.m. Monday, a sheriff's dispatcher said Tuesday.
